#a26850 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a26850 is composed of 63.5% red, 40.8%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#a26850 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0a0 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a26850 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#a26850 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a26850 has RGB values of R:162, G:104,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.51,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10643536.

Shades and Tints of #a26850

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a26850

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7775 is the less saturated color, while #ec4906 is the most saturated one.
